Last expenses are the costs your family spends for your burial or cremation, and for other points you may want at that time, like a gathering to celebrate your life. Thinking concerning final expenses can be hard, recognizing what they cost and making sure you have a life insurance policy huge sufficient to cover them can help spare your household a cost they might not have the ability to manage.
One option is Funeral service Preplanning Insurance coverage which permits you select funeral services and products, and fund them with the purchase of an insurance coverage. Another alternative is Final Cost Insurance. This type of insurance coverage provides funds directly to your beneficiary to aid pay for funeral service and other expenses. The quantity of your final expenditures relies on a number of points, including where you reside in the USA and what type of last plans you desire.
It is predicted that in 2023, 34.5 percent of households will certainly choose funeral and a greater percent of family members, 60.5 percent, will choose cremation1. It's approximated that by 2045 81.4 percent of family members will choose cremation2. One reason cremation is ending up being extra preferred is that can be much less pricey than interment.
Relying on what your or your family want, things like burial stories, serious markers or headstones, and caskets can boost the cost. There might likewise be expenses in enhancement to the ones particularly for burial or cremation. They could include: Covering the cost of traveling for household and liked ones so they can participate in a service Catered meals and various other expenses for an event of your life after the service Acquisition of unique clothing for the service As soon as you have an excellent concept what your final expenses will certainly be, you can aid prepare for them with the best insurance coverage.
Medicare just covers medically necessary expenses that are needed for the diagnosis and treatment of a health problem or problem. Funeral costs are not taken into consideration medically required and for that reason aren't covered by Medicare. Last expense insurance coverage offers an easy and reasonably affordable means to cover these expenditures, with policy advantages ranging from $5,000 to $20,000 or even more.
Individuals typically buy last expenditure insurance policy with the purpose that the beneficiary will use it to spend for funeral expenses, arrearages, probate charges, or other associated expenditures.
